Introduction to the use of SMath Studio
Prepared by Gilberto E. Urroz, May 2010
Where to find
SMath Studio?
SMath Studio 0.88
is freeware that produces notebook type of mathematical calculations.
You can download
SMath Studio
at this web site:
http://en.smath.info/forum/default.aspx?g=posts&t=425
Getting started
You will find the icon for
SMath Studio
in the folder
SMath\SMath Studio
under your
Program Files
folder in your
Windows
machine, or under your
Program Files (x86)
folder if you have a
64-bit
version of
Windows.
The program is called
SMathStudio_Desktop.exe.
You may want to create a shortcut to the program to place in
your desktop or in your
Quick Launch.
Double click on the program icon or on the
shortcut to open the
SMath Studio
interface.
The
SMath Studio
interface
To get started, find the
SMath
Studio Desktop
icon in your
Start>Programs
button in
Windows. The
SMath Studio
interface is shown here.
The interface shows a main
window with menus, a toolbar,
and a number of palettes on the
right-hand side of the interface.
The palettes contain
mathematical, graphical, and
programming functions that can
be placed in the main window
with the purpose of calculating
mathematical expression,
producing graphs, or building
small programs.
The
SMath Studio
menus
The
SMath Studio
interface
contains menus entitled
File,
Edit, View, Insert, Calculation,
Tools, Pages,
and
Help.
Besides these 8 menus, there is also a menu indicated by a page
icon located to the left of the menu bar. We'll refer to this menu as the
Control
menu.
Explore the different menus to become acquainted with the various options available in
them. The operation of the
Control, File,
and
Edit
menus is very similar to those of
other
Windows
applications, hence, the item therein contained would be familiar to
Windows
users. Other menus are presented below.

The
Help
menu
The
Help
menu contains the option
Reference book…
which represents a modest attempt
by the author to address basic mathematical operations and definitions. The contents of
the
Reference book
are shown in the figure below. To find the contents of a particular
section of the
Reference book,
click on that section. For example, to see the contents of
the section entitled
Identical Transformations,
click on the corresponding link to produce
the screen in the middle. If you click on the link entitled
Properties of arithmetic roots,
you get the screen shown to the right in the figure below. This provides some basic
properties of limits that can be useful to review those concepts from algebra.
You can go back one page in the
Reference book
by pressing the option
Back,
or return to
the Contents page by pressing the option
Home.
The menu option
Copy
lets you copy
equations from the
Reference book
that you can then paste in the main interface. To copy
a specific equation, first highlight the equation you want to copy, then press
Copy,
and
paste the equation (using, for example,
Cntl-v)
onto the main screen.
The
Help
menu also contains the option
Examples,
which opens the following menu of
examples:
Click on a given example to select it, and press the [ Open ] button. The worksheet
corresponding to the example
Numeric integration method (Simpson's rule)
is shown
below.

The
Pages
menu
The
Pages
menu shows the pages (worksheets) currently
open. After having opened the worksheet for the
example shown above, the
Pages
menu will show two
pages open, namely,
Page1,the
default page open when
we started
SMath Studio,
and
Simpson.sm,
the worksheet
we just opened from the
Examples
menu.
The
Pages
menu also shows the options
New page
and
Close page,
whose operation is
obvious.
The
Tools
menu
The
Tools
menu has two items (Options... and
Plugins...).
The
Options...
item opens the
following dialogue form with two tabs as shown below.

The
Calculation
tab in the
Options
interface lets you modify basic settings for
mathematical calculations, whereas the
Interface
option deals with properties of the
interface window. Click on the different drop-down menus to select the setting you
would like to change.
The
Plugins
item in the
Tools
menu produces the following interface:
SMath Studio 0.88
includes the three plugins shown above, namely:
•
•
•
HTML Export:
allows to save files to HTML format
Special Functions:
handles a number of functions. Scroll down the cursor to the
right to see all functions available. A brief description of the functions is
included.
XMCD Files:
allows to save and open XMCD files. This format is used by the
commercial software
Mathcad.
The
Insert
menu
The
Insert
menu allows inserting a variety of items into the worksheet (or page), as
indicated in the figure below:
page 4
© Gilberto E. Urroz, May 2010
When you select the option
Matrix..
, for example, it produces an entry form that allows
you build a matrix of a pre-determined size:
The option
Function…
opens up a menu of mathematical functions, i.e.,
Selecting the option
Operator…
in the
Insert
menu produces a list of Boolean, arithmetic,
and other operators, e.g.,
